Godwin benefits from Mayfield's early-season form and improved health in 2026
Chris GodwinWRTB
Chris Godwin could benefit from Baker Mayfield's improved health; Mayfield averaged 256.5 YPG over the first six games of 2025 before injuries, which bodes well for Godwin's production. The source lists him as a 2026 watch player: Round 3 NFL Draft pick, age 31, with Evans gone, healthy status, and Mayfield health as tailwinds.
